Terry J. Reedy added the comment: I have been putting off re-writing findfiles because it partly duplicates os.listdir, which should perhaps be used instead, except that a new, improved, os.scandir is in the works: PEP 471 and #22524.
I believe filefiles currently searches depth first, whereas I would generally prefer breadth first.
